Why Join Us?
Check Point’s new API Security team is expanding, and we’re looking for a talented Frontend or Full Stack Developer to help shape the future of API security. As part of our CloudGuard WAF product, you will be building cutting-edge user interfaces and backend services that enable advanced features like API discovery, sensitive data detection, anomaly detection, and more. This is a unique opportunity to directly influence both our product and the broader API security industry.
Why Join Us?
- Be part of a new team in a global, stable company, working in a fast-paced, start-up-like environment.
- Shape the future of API security—your work will have an impact not just on our product but on the industry itself.
- Tackle diverse, cutting-edge challenges in API discovery, anomaly detection, sensitive data handling, and more.
- Collaborate with passionate colleagues, expand your skills, and grow your career in one of the most exciting domains in cybersecurity.
Key Responsibilities
- Develop and Maintain UI: Build intuitive, performant, and secure front-end interfaces for our API security solution.
- Collaborate Across Teams: Work closely with UX designers, backend developers, and product managers to deliver seamless user experiences.
- Implement Full-Stack Features: (If full stack) Design and develop server-side components and RESTful APIs that integrate with the front end.
- Data Visualization: Integrate analytics and big data insights into the UI to help customers identify and mitigate security threats.
- Agile Development: Write clean, maintainable code in an agile environment, adhering to best practices and security standards.
- Continuous Learning: Stay current with evolving frontend frameworks, tooling, and API security trends, integrating new technologies where appropriate.
Qualifications
- 2+ Years of Experience
- Fast Learner: Able to quickly pick up new technologies in a rapidly evolving domain.
- Frontend Expertise: Proficiency in modern JavaScript/TypeScript frameworks (e.g., React, Angular, or Vue).
- UI/UX Focus: Understanding of user-centric design principles and the ability to translate requirements into intuitive interfaces.
- Backend Familiarity: (For full stack) Experience with server-side languages (Node.js, Python, Go, etc.) and RESTful APIs.
- Problem-Solving Skills: Ability to design and adapt solutions in a dynamic, multi-tasked environment.
Advantages
- Networking & Infrastructure: Familiarity with API gateways, reverse proxies, Nginx, or similar technologies.
- Advanced Data Analysis: Knowledge of data analysis methodologies or frameworks to visualize security insights.
- Data Science Interest: Eagerness to learn and apply data science principles to detect anomalies and threats.
- Containerization & Orchestration: Hands-on experience with Docker, Kubernetes, and Linux environments.
- HTTP & Security: Strong understanding of the HTTP protocol and web security best practices (XSS, CSRF, etc.).
- Cross-System Architecture: Proven ability to design and implement complex, scalable systems across diverse environments.